My 2023 M's roster thoughts in a nutshell.
I do not want to see Trammel - Wanker - Haniger or Lewis anywhere in the system. I just think it's time to move on from mediocrity if we want to truly contend for post season play and have any hopes of reaching the division leader ( who will not be named except for * )
Bundle the above players up or sell individually or whatever yields the greatest return either money to purchase MLB talent or trade for MLB ready talent to help the club contend / succeed.
Keep Marco and convince him he is an asset as a LH reliever out of the pen. That is his greatest help to the Mariners moving forward.
To fill the #5 starter slot we have both Brash and Flexen and should consider any other upgrade within budget or trade realism.
Kelenic deserves his shot at breaking spring camp and if he earns a spot in the OF with the big club... let him play his way and show everyone what he can contribute. tell him it's his time to show everyone. if he thinks he can hit .285 with 180 base hits and drive in 70 rbi as a table setter ... or if he can produce more swinging for the fences and batting .240 with 30 bombs and 100+ rbi's the choice is his. He has a higher ceiling than any prospect in the .org and likely higher than any prospect we could trade for. He deserves the shot. ( IF a big IF he breaks camp and has EARNED a spot on the 25 man roster as a starter in our OF ) He has always been a late season or mid season callup and just maybe starting the season in the bigs is what gives him the confidance to play to he=is natural ability. if by the ASB he is struggling ... send him packing for greener pastures. 300 ab's is enough time 2023 to show what he can do to help us. It is last chance for gas.
Ty France to DH and he needs some Jenny Craig help this off season. Add a big bat 1st basemen or E. White needs to put up or shut up. If he cannot contribute ... he can split a cab with Kelenic at the ASB as well.
Frazier I am on the fence about. He is most likely to improve 2023 over his 2022 production. For the right price I think we hold onto him ( unless we sign a big infielder and can mover Crawford or the signee to 2nd base )
BIG need for an outfielder with a big stick. having 1 question mark in our OF is bad enough ... we sure as hell don't need 2
